About the Role:

Pika is seeking a dynamic and skilled lead product engineer to join our team. An ideal candidate will be passionate about technology and innovation, with a focus on creating exceptional products that drive value for our customers. As a lead product engineer at Pika, you will collaborate closely with our tech and creative teams to design, develop, and launch products that meet our customers' needs.

Responsibilities:

  • Develop high-quality products that meet customers’ needs and business objectives.
  • Continuously evaluate and improve product performance, scalability, and usability. 
  • Stay up-to-date with emerging technologies and industry trends to drive innovation and maintain a competitive edge.
  • Work closely with product managers, designers, and other engineers to define product requirements and specifications.

Requirements:

  • Bachelor’s Degree in Computer Science, related technical field or relevant work experience.
  • Minimum 4 years of experience in software engineering with focus on product development.
  • Experience with frontend, backend, or full-stack is a plus.
  • Former experience of working at startups is a plus.
  • Proficiency in programming languages such as Python, C++, Java, or JavaScript.
  • Strong problem-solving skills and high attention to detail.
  • Excellent communication and collaboration skills, with the ability to work efficiently in fast-paced and team-oriented environments.
  • Ability to manage multiple tasks simultaneously and meet deadlines.

ABOUT PIKA

At Pika, we’re crafting a future where video creation is seamless, intuitive, and universally accessible. Our vision is set on a world where videos transcend entertainment, serving as a canvas for everyone's unique expression. Harnessing AI's transformative power, we aim to dismantle the technical barriers that have traditionally made video production an exclusive field. It’s about building the best technology that upholds the power of creativity—not just within our products but as an integral part of our culture.

We’re a small team of energetic, smart and curious individuals. We value efficiency, collaboration, and creativity. We seek new team members who bring sharp intellect, a strong work ethic, and the ambition to make an impact. Here, you'll find significant room for career advancement, supported by a culture that nurtures both individual and collective development.

Our headquarters is based in Palo Alto, CA.
